Dr. Burch to participate in Harvard leadership class

Ann Lee Burch, PT, MS, MPH, EdD, vice dean and associate professor, Arizona School of Health Sciences, has been selected as a member of the Women in Education Leadership, Class of 2014, at Harvard Graduate School of Education. The forum is designed to convene a cohort of senior leaders interested in strengthening and leveraging their leadership […]

Alum chosen as 2014 Citizen of the Year

James A. O’Connor, DO, ’67, medical care director, St. Luke’s Clinic, Jackson, Mich., was chosen as the 2014 Jackson Citizen Patriot Citizen of the Year. For the past 13 years, Dr. O’Connor has volunteered his time and changed the lives of thousands of Jackson County residents in need of free medical care. He also works […]

Faculty featured as health expert

Neil Sargentini, PhD, microbiology/immunology chair, was recently featured as a health expert on behalf of A.T. Still University-Kirksville College of Osteopathic Medicine. Dr. Sargentini weighed on on the flu vaccine, featured in an article by Wallet Hub. Read the article here.

Friday Night Live: ATSU-ASDOH hosts talent show

A.T. Still University’s Arizona School of Dentistry & Oral Health (ATSU-ASDOH) Arizona Student Dentistry Association (ASDA) hosted their 4th Annual Charity Talent show on Friday, Dec. 13, 2013. Participants included students, faculty and staff from ATSU-ASDOH as well as from the other schools on campus. Ticket sales from the show benefited the Child Crisis Center. […]
